By Day, Sun Studio Draws Tourists. At Night, Musicians Lay Down Tracks.
Briefly

The iconic Sun Studio in Memphis is not just a museum; it's a living space where the past of rock 'n' roll mingles with its present.
As tourists step on the same linoleum as Elvis and Cash, the energy shifts from nostalgia to creativity, welcoming new artists into the legendary studio.
